Tractor Repair: case 885 xl 4 wd, piston seals, 4 wd


Question
problem .rear hitch/lift arms drop 5 mins after tractor is stopped.trailer tipping is perfect.steering is perfect.it seems ther is a big oil leak on either the piston or piston relief valve

Answer
Hello,

  Either the piston seals are leaking, or if the lift cylinder has a cushion relief valve, it could be leaking.  It could also be a sticking spool or check valve in the hitch control valve.  No matter which of these is the problem, the lift cover will have to come off to get at everything.  While it's apart, do an air check with compressed air and a rubber tipped blow gun to find a leak in the control valve.  Make sure all spools in the valve move smoothly with no sticky spots.  To check the piston, it will have to be removed and the seals inspected or if in doubt, just replace them.  Look for any scoring on the inside of the cylinder also.
